Register for the promotion below by becoming a TrueBlue member, or just log into your TrueBlue account from this page
Book a roundtrip flight(s) online by September 18, 2007
Travel by October 15, 2007
On November 1, 2007, we'll email you an electronic $50 Voucher redeemable for travel on JetBlue between December 1, 2007 and February 13, 2008* to any of the 50-plus places we fly. PLUS we'll give you 20 BONUS TrueBlue points for every eligible roundtrip you fly

Does "Travel by October 15" mean that the roundtrip must be completed by October 15, or only the departure?
I asked a jetBlue reservations person and they said only the first leg of the RT has to be completed by Oct. 15. I hope she is correct because my return flight is on the 15th and the only reason I booked the flight is because of this offer.
Can anyone shed some light on this?

Should have remembered this from an MIS class... clear the damn cookies when booking anything online!
when following a link from AMEX web site where it still says get $10 off you will get that, $10 bux off...
but when you do it through another link, like say a SlickDeals.org $15 off link, you will get the $15 bux off...
just something to remember when booking future discounted travel.
